Bigdog Mastiff 2006

Model Mastiff made in 2006 by Bigdog got 6 recalls as well as 24 service bulletins. Technical service bulletines regarding communications and electrical system. There were some recalls concerningelectrical system and structure.

ELECTRICAL SYSTEM
06V305000BIG DOG MOTORCYCLES, LLC V (Vehicle)210109/19/2006MFRBIG DOG MOTORCYCLES, LLC08/11/200608/11/2006
Defect SummaryOn certain motorcycles, the electronic harness control (ehc) module can fail resulting in a total shut down of the vehicle's electronic power.
Consequence SummaryThis condition could occur without any prior warning and could result in a crash.
Corrective SummaryDealers will replace the ehc modules free of charge. the recall began on september 19, 2006. owners may contact big dog at 316-267-9121.

ELECTRICAL SYSTEM - ALTERNATOR/GENERATOR/REGULATOR
07V356000BIG DOG MOTORCYCLES, LLCfrom 07/13/2005 to 10/13/2006V (Vehicle)761110/01/2007MFRBIG DOG MOTORCYCLES, LLC08/08/200708/15/2007
Defect SummaryOn certain motorcycles, a warped bus bar within the voltage regulator can cause a short circuit.
Consequence SummaryThis could possibly result in a fire.
Corrective SummaryDealers will replace the existing circuit breaker located between the voltage regulator positive battery lead (b+ lead) and the positive battery terminal with an alternative circuit protection device that will prevent a thermal event if there is a short to ground. the recall began on october 1, 2007. owners may contact big dog at 1-316-219-9129 or email to customer.service@bigdogmotorcycles.com.

ELECTRICAL SYSTEM - IGNITION - MODULE
06V301000BIG DOG MOTORCYCLES, LLCfrom 09/10/2004 to 07/24/2006V (Vehicle)271108/25/2006MFRBIG DOG MOTORCYCLES, LLC08/09/200608/09/2006
Defect SummaryOn certain motorcycles, the ignition modules are oriented within the battery tray in a way that makes the ignition module susceptible to vibration.
Consequence SummaryThis susceptibility to vibration may contribute to a stalling condition that could occur without any prior warning and result in a crash.
Corrective SummaryDealers will install a new ignition module mounting system free of charge. the recall began on august 25, 2006. owners may contact big dog at 316-267-9121.

STRUCTURE
06V389000BIG DOG MOTORCYCLES, LLCfrom 09/10/2004 to 04/12/2006V (Vehicle)249411/01/2006MFRBIG DOG MOTORCYCLES, LLC10/12/200610/12/2006
Defect SummaryOn certain motorcycles, the long pivot bolt may bend or break during normal operation of the motorcycle.
Consequence SummaryThis could potentially cause the rear fender to abrade against the rear tire while the motorcycle is being driven. this condition could occur without any prior warning and could result in a crash.
Corrective SummaryDealers will replace the long pivot bolt and, if necessary, straighten the rear frame side panel. the short left side pivot bolt and pivot shaft may also be replaced free of charge. the recall began on november 1, 2006. owners may contact big dog at 316-267-9121.

STRUCTURE - BODY
07V580000BIG DOG MOTORCYCLES, LLCfrom 09/10/2004 to 11/30/2007V (Vehicle)806101/21/2008MFRBIG DOG MOTORCYCLES, LLC12/18/200712/18/2007
Defect SummaryOn certain motorcycles, the rear fender strut attaching bolts can fail allowing the rear fender to detach from the motorcycle.
Consequence SummaryThis could occur without prior warning and could result in an injury or a crash.
Corrective SummaryDealers will remove existing strut bolts and replace with higher tensile strength attaching bolts and updated washers. higher torque values will be observed when installing the replacement fasteners. the recall began on january 21, 2008. owners may contact big dog at 316-267-9121.

STRUCTURE - MOTORCYCLE KICKSTAND/CENTER STAND
06V019000BIG DOG MOTORCYCLES, LLCfrom 08/08/2003 to 01/13/2006V (Vehicle)972602/17/2006MFRBIG DOG MOTORCYCLES, LLC01/25/200601/25/2006
Defect SummaryOn certain motorcycles, the kickstand spring may stretch and detach from the mounting bracket or the kickstand.
Consequence SummaryThis will allow the kickstand to deploy into the extended position and cause a crash.
Corrective SummaryDealers will install a new kickstand spring free of charge. the recall began on february 17, 2006. owners may contact big dog at 316-267-9121.
